Core Features and Functionality
OptiMonk’s strength is its versatility. It supports exit-intent surveys alongside various popup types including banners and sidebars. Its A/B testing and extensive targeting qualify it as a CRO-focused platform. However, some users find the UI less intuitive than others.
Wisepops adds AI product recommendations to its exit-intent surveys, which can boost ecommerce upselling. Campaign targeting is flexible, but the tool lacks some advanced testing features OptiMonk offers.
Popupsmart’s no-code builder is simple, allowing quick popup creation with geo-targeting options for location-specific offers. It is lighter on advanced features but excels in mobile optimization and ease of use.
Pricing and Value
OptiMonk starts at $29/month for up to 5,000 visitors, with plans scaling based on traffic volume. Free trial availability helps businesses test the platform without commitment. Higher tiers unlock advanced targeting and integrations.
Wisepops begins at $49/month with no free tier, positioning it at the higher end for small businesses. Pricing scales with traffic and features. Its entry cost may deter very small businesses.
Popupsmart offers a free tier for basic use and starts paid plans at around $21/month. The pricing is competitive for startups or smaller stores but advanced features may require higher tiers.
Ease of Setup and Use
OptiMonk’s drag-and-drop editor is functional but can feel complex for newcomers. Initial setup requires some time investment to optimize campaigns fully.
Wisepops is generally praised for ease of use, with quick setup and a clean interface designed for non-technical users.
Popupsmart is the simplest to get started with, featuring a no-code environment and minimal configuration steps. Its design is friendly for users needing fast implementation with less training.
Integrations
All three tools integrate well with major ecommerce platforms. OptiMonk covers Shopify, WooCommerce, BigCommerce, and Zapier, suitable for diverse tech stacks.
Wisepops focuses heavily on Shopify and Magento, plus marketing tools like Mailchimp, catering well to online stores with heavy CRM needs.
Popupsmart supports Shopify and WordPress, plus Google Analytics and Zapier, providing solid connectivity for basic ecommerce setups.
Customer Support and Documentation
OptiMonk offers email support, live chat during business hours, a knowledge base, and webinars. Some users report slower response times on complex queries.
Wisepops provides responsive email and chat support plus detailed documentation. Customer feedback is positive regarding support quality.
Popupsmart delivers responsive email and chat assistance, supported by tutorials and a helpful knowledge base. Its support is rated highly for responsiveness.
Best-Fit Customer Profile
OptiMonk suits small ecommerce businesses focused on conversion optimization, with moderate budget and willingness to invest time in fine-tuning campaigns.
Wisepops appeals to Shopify-centric businesses wanting AI-driven upselling and more sophisticated campaign targeting, willing to pay a premium for those features.
Popupsmart is best for startups or smaller stores needing quick, easy exit-intent popup deployment with geographic targeting and limited technical resources.

When to Choose Each Tool
Choose OptiMonk if you want a feature-rich platform with A/B testing and detailed targeting to improve conversion rates and survey performance. It suits stores ready to experiment and fine-tune campaigns.
Wisepops is appropriate for Shopify businesses looking for AI-powered recommendations integrated directly into exit-intent popups. It fits merchants who want a more guided upsell experience and don’t mind a higher price.
Popupsmart fits startups or budget-conscious small businesses needing a straightforward, easy to use, no-code popup tool with geographic targeting to customize offers by visitor location.
